public DeviceInterfaceFileParser( ParserContext context, IContentNodeFactory contentNodeFactory, ISchemaNodeFactory schemaNodeFactory, IFieldNodesFactory fieldNodesFactory) { this.context = context; this.contentNodeFactory = contentNodeFactory; this.schemaNodeFactory = schemaNodeFactory; this.fieldNodesFactory = fieldNodesFactory; }
public ContentObject(IEnumerable <KeyValuePair <string, object> > dataSource, object rawData, IContentNodeFactory contentFactory) { DataSource = dataSource ?? throw new ArgumentNullException(nameof(dataSource)); _rawValue = rawData; _contentFactory = contentFactory ?? throw new ArgumentNullException(nameof(contentFactory)); }
public FromClrPoco(IContentNodeFactory memberFactory, IContentSchemaNodeFactory schemaFactory) { _memberFactory = memberFactory; _schemaFactory = schemaFactory; }
public FromClrIEnumerable(IContentNodeFactory itemFactory, IContentSchemaNodeFactory schemaFactory) { _itemFactory = itemFactory; _schemaFactory = schemaFactory; }
public ContentList(IEnumerable dataSource, object rawValue, IContentNodeFactory contentFactory) { DataSource = dataSource ?? throw new ArgumentNullException(nameof(rawValue)); _rawValue = rawValue ?? throw new ArgumentNullException(nameof(rawValue)); _contentFactory = contentFactory ?? throw new ArgumentNullException(nameof(contentFactory)); }
public FromJToken(IContentNodeFactory contentFactory) { _contentFactory = contentFactory; }
public FromClrDictionary(IContentNodeFactory memberFactory, IContentSchemaNodeFactory schemaFactory) { _memberFactory = memberFactory; _schemaFactory = schemaFactory; }